Mesothelioma Attorneys

Mesothelioma lawyers understand how the disease affects families and help patients focus on getting well. They know how to pursue various forms of compensation and claims.

A mesothelioma lawyer who is qualified can help patients identify exposure sources, including asbestos-related businesses and high-risk professions. They can also assist veterans receive VA benefits.

They can help you determine the value of your damages.

In mesothelioma lawsuits and settlements lawsuits the award of economic damages is made to cover medical expenses and lost wage. To get the maximum value from a mesothelioma lawsuit, it's also important to address suffering and pain. A mesothelioma attorney can assist victims in gathering evidence to support their claims for this kind of compensation, like detailed medical bills and pay stubs.

Additionally, mesothelioma lawyers can determine the amount the case of a victim's worth based on their geographical location and asbestos exposure history. Since states have different rules for how to divide liability among multiple defendants, these elements affect a plaintiff's bargaining ability and the possible outcome of their case.

Numerous options for compensation are available to mesothelioma patients such as the asbestos-based state trust fund as well as private companies that produced and used asbestos.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ist victims in obtaining the most effective compensation by seeking compensation from every source.

Compensation from mesothelioma lawsuits can assist victims with paying for their medical bills or travel to and from mesothelioma treatment centers. It can also help them cover the cost of living and support their families, particularly in the event of the loss of loved ones due to mesothelioma.

Sometimes, defendants offer early settlements to avoid the glare and expense of a mesothelioma lawsuit trial claims. They may also settle after the discovery phase or during trial as the evidence becomes stronger and more clear.

The insurance policies of large corporations could cover the costs and damages caused by mesothelioma lawsuits (Suggested Website). Their insurers will play a major influence on when or if these companies decide to settle a case, as well as the amount of money they offer in settlements.

In addition, mesothelioma lawsuits that go to trial may result in a higher jury verdict than cases that are settled out of court. However, a trial may be more lengthy and complex than a settlement, which is why it is essential to choose an attorney with expertise in bringing cases to trial. They can assist you in filing a Wrongful Death Claim

A reputable mesothelioma lawyer has the expertise, resources, and connections to employ experts such as industrial hygienists to help build a strong case. They also know the complexity of mesothelioma law firms compensation and will be able to provide evidence to win the highest amount of compensation. Mesothelioma lawyers will operate on a contingent fee basis. This means that they are only paid if their clients receive compensation.

Compensation from mesothelioma lawsuits that are successful is intended to cover medical expenses funeral expenses as well as loss of income and many more. Compensation can include non-economic damages, like emotional distress and loss of consortium. The final decision of a jury will be dependent on what the judge or jury determines to be the proper amount of these damages.

If a mesothelioma sufferer dies before the lawsuit reaches a resolution, their claim will convert into a wrongful death lawsuit. At that point, any award of compensation would become part of the estate of the deceased and passed on to their beneficiaries. A loved one may become their estate representative in order to continue pursuing the lawsuit on their behalf.

The claims for wrongful death are typically more challenging than personal injury lawsuits. This is because the plaintiff will no longer be living to serve as a witness and provide specific information about their exposure background, and testify on how the illness has affected their lives. It can be difficult to locate witnesses, get documents, or confirm asbestos exposure areas after the death of a person.

The amount of compensation for wrongful deaths is typically more expensive than settlements for personal injury, but they do not always reflect the full extent of the loss suffered by the victim.
